LEBEN TANRIKULU
Werfen Sie einen neuen Blick auf Ihren Lebensstil.

Spieldesign-Programm

Spieledesign-Programmesind Software, die Spieleentwickler bei der Erstellung von 2D- und 3D-Spielen unterstützt. Diese Programme können in allen Phasen der Spieleentwicklung eingesetzt werden, einschließlich Modellierung, Animation, Texturierung, Codierung und Sounddesign.


Game-Design-Programme sind Software, die Benutzer beim Entwerfen, Entwickeln und Verteilen ihrer Spiele verwenden können. Diese Programme bieten eine Vielzahl von Tools und Funktionen für Benutzer mit unterschiedlichen Schwierigkeitsgraden und Anforderungen. Mit diesen Programmen können Spieleentwickler Prototypen ihrer Spiele erstellen, Grafiken und Code erstellen und andere technische Aspekte des Spiels verwalten.

Es gibt viele verschiedene Spieledesign-Programme auf dem Markt. Jedes Programm hat seine eigenen einzigartigen Funktionen und Benutzerfreundlichkeit. Es gibt viele verschiedene Programme und Tools für das Gamedesign. Hier sind einige beliebte Programme, die häufig im Spieldesignprozess verwendet werden:

  1. Einheit: Unity ist eine der beliebtesten und am weitesten verbreiteten Spiele-Engines für Spieleentwickler. Es kann zur Entwicklung von 2D- und 3D-Spielen verwendet werden. Unity verfügt über eine große Community und bietet eine flexible Infrastruktur für die Veröffentlichung von Spielen auf verschiedenen Plattformen (PC, Mobilgerät, Web, Konsole usw.). Darüber hinaus stehen im Unity Asset Store viele vorgefertigte Assets und Plugins zur Verfügung.
  2. Unwirkliche Engine: Unreal Engine ist eine weitere Spiele-Engine, die einen starken Platz in der Spieleentwicklungsbranche einnimmt. Unreal Engine legt besonderen Wert auf visuelle Qualität und Grafik. Unreal Engine verfügt über ein visuelles Codierungstool namens Blueprint, das den Spieleentwicklungsprozess für diejenigen vereinfacht, die keine Programmierkenntnisse haben.
  3. GameMaker Studio: GameMaker Studio ist eine beliebte Option, insbesondere für diejenigen, die 2D-Spiele entwickeln möchten. GameMaker zeichnet sich durch seine benutzerfreundlichen und schnellen Prototyping-Funktionen aus. Es verfügt über eine benutzerfreundliche Drag-and-Drop-Oberfläche für Benutzer ohne Programmierkenntnisse.
  4. Godot-Engine: Godot ist eine Open-Source- und kostenlose Spiel-Engine. Godot kann für die Entwicklung von 2D- und 3D-Spielen eingesetzt werden und erfreut sich vor allem bei kleineren Studios und unabhängigen Entwicklern großer Beliebtheit. Godot ist als flexible und anpassbare Spiel-Engine bekannt.
  5. Konstruieren: Construct ist eine geeignete Option, insbesondere für diejenigen, die keine Programmierkenntnisse haben. Benutzer können ihre Spiele mit einer Drag-and-Drop-Oberfläche erstellen und erweiterte Funktionen mit Construct Script, einer JavaScript-basierten Sprache, hinzufügen. Construct eignet sich ideal zum Erstellen webbasierter Spiele.

Diese Programme sprechen Spieleentwickler mit unterschiedlichen Fähigkeiten und Bedürfnissen an. Es ist wichtig, Ihre Bedürfnisse, Ziele und Ihr Erfahrungsniveau zu berücksichtigen, um festzustellen, welches Programm für Sie am besten geeignet ist. Jedes hat seine eigenen Vor- und Nachteile. Sie können also einige ausprobieren, um dasjenige zu finden, das für Sie am besten geeignet ist.

Lassen Sie uns nun Spieledesignprogramme in Anfänger, Fortgeschrittene und Fortgeschrittene einteilen.

Game-Design-Programme für Anfänger

  • Unwirkliche Engine: Es ist ein leistungsstarker und vielseitiger Motor. Es wurde zur Erstellung von AAA-Spielen, Filmen und VR-Erlebnissen verwendet. Allerdings kann es etwas schwierig sein, es zu lernen.
  • Einheit: Die Engine ist benutzerfreundlicher und kann zum Erstellen von 2D- und 3D-Spielen verwendet werden. Es verfügt außerdem über eine große Online-Community, die eine großartige Lernressource für Anfänger darstellt.

Spieledesign-Programme für fortgeschrittene Benutzer

  • Godot: Es handelt sich um eine kostenlose Open-Source-Engine, mit der 2D- und 3D-Spiele erstellt werden können. Es ist außerdem relativ einfach zu erlernen und anzuwenden.
  • GameMaker Studio: Es ist ein großartiges Programm zum Erstellen von 2D-Spielen. Es ist einfach zu bedienen und enthält viele Funktionen.

Game-Design-Programme für erfahrene Benutzer

  • CryEngine: Es handelt sich um eine leistungsstarke und vielseitige Engine, die zur Erstellung von AAA-Spielen verwendet wird. Es kann jedoch recht schwierig sein, es zu erlernen und anzuwenden.
  • Holzplatz: Es handelt sich um eine kostenlose und Open-Source-AAA-Spiele-Engine, die von Amazon entwickelt wurde. Es ist ziemlich schwierig zu bedienen, enthält aber viele Funktionen.

Zu berücksichtigende Faktoren bei der Auswahl eines Spieledesignprogramms:

  • Preis: Spieledesign-Programme können von kostenlos bis sehr teuer reichen. Es ist wichtig, dass Sie diejenige auswählen, die für Ihr Budget am besten geeignet ist.
  • Özellikler: Verschiedene Spieledesign-Programme bieten unterschiedliche Funktionen. Es ist wichtig, ein Programm zu wählen, das über alle Funktionen verfügt, die Sie benötigen.
  • Lernkurve: Einige Spieledesign-Programme sind einfacher zu erlernen als andere. Es ist wichtig, ein Programm zu wählen, das Ihrem Kenntnisstand entspricht.
  • Unterstützung: Bei der Auswahl eines Game-Design-Programms ist es wichtig, eines zu wählen, das gute Unterstützung bietet. Wenn Sie nicht weiterkommen oder Hilfe benötigen, sollten Sie in der Lage sein, Hilfe zu bekommen.

Merkmale von Game-Design-Programmen:


Game-Design-Programme bieten eine Vielzahl von Funktionen für jede Phase der Spieleentwicklung. Zu den häufigsten Funktionen gehören:

  • Modellieren: Es dient zur Erstellung von 3D-Modellen.
  • Animation: Es wird verwendet, um 3D-Modellen Bewegung hinzuzufügen.
  • Textur erstellen: Es wird verwendet, um 3D-Modellen Farbe und Textur hinzuzufügen.
  • Codierung: Es wird verwendet, um die Logik und den Betrieb des Spiels zu programmieren.
  • Audiogestaltung: Es wird verwendet, um Soundeffekte und Musik für das Spiel zu erstellen.

Vorteile der Verwendung von Game-Design-Programmen:

Game-Design-Programme bieten viele Vorteile, die die Spieleentwicklung einfacher und schneller machen. Einige dieser Vorteile sind:

  • Visuelle Programmierung: Mit visuellen Programmiertools können Spiele erstellt werden, ohne dass Programmierkenntnisse erforderlich sind.
  • Debugging-Tools: Mit Debugging-Tools können Spielfehler gefunden und behoben werden.
  • Vorbereitete Assets: Vorgefertigte Modelle, Animationen und Texturen können für den Einsatz in Spielen verwendet werden.
  • Bildungsressourcen: Es stehen viele Online-Bildungsressourcen zur Verfügung, um mehr über Spieledesign-Programme zu erfahren.

Nachteile der Verwendung von Game-Design-Programmen:

Game-Design-Programme haben auch einige Nachteile. Einige dieser Nachteile sind:

  • System Anforderungen: Einige Spieledesignprogramme erfordern einen leistungsstarken Computer.
  • Lernkurve: Einige Spieledesign-Programme können schwierig zu erlernen sein.
  • Kosten: Einige Spieledesign-Programme können recht teuer sein.

Arten von Game-Design-Programmen:

Spiel-Engines und Entwicklungstools lassen sich im Allgemeinen in drei Hauptkategorien einteilen:

  • Spiel-Engines: Game Engines sind Komplettlösungen, die die Grundlage der Spieleentwicklung bilden. Sie kümmern sich um viele technische Aspekte der Spieleentwicklung, wie z. B. 3D-Grafik-Rendering, Physiksimulation, künstliche Intelligenz, Soundmanagement und mehr. Programme wie Unreal Engine, Unity und CryEngine fallen in diese Kategorie.
  • Spieleentwicklungstools: Obwohl sie nicht so umfassend wie Spiele-Engines sind, sind Spieleentwicklungstools darauf ausgelegt, bei bestimmten Spieleentwicklungsaufgaben zu helfen. Zu diesen Tools können Plattformen für die Entwicklung von 2D-Spielen, 3D-Modellierungs- und Animationssoftware, Sounddesign-Tools und Tools zur Textübersetzung im Spiel gehören. Beispielsweise kann die Godot Engine als Spiel-Engine verwendet werden, während ein Programm wie Construct 2, das sich speziell auf die Entwicklung von 3D-Spielen konzentriert, als Spielentwicklungstool bezeichnet wird.
  • Integrierte Entwicklungsumgebungen (IDEs): IDEs sind Softwareprogramme, die das Schreiben von Code erleichtern sollen. Codierung ist ein wichtiger Teil der Spieleentwicklung und Spiele-Engines verfügen häufig über eigene integrierte Code-Editoren. Einige Spieleentwickler bevorzugen jedoch die Verwendung eigenständiger IDEs anstelle der Code-Editoren der Spiele-Engines. Auch beliebte IDEs wie Visual Studio und JetBrains Rider können für die Spieleentwicklung genutzt werden.

Detaillierte Übersicht über beliebte Spieledesign-Programme:

1. Unreal Engine:


  • Überblick: Die von Epic Games entwickelte Unreal Engine ist eine leistungsstarke und vielseitige Spiele-Engine, die häufig von AAA-Spieleentwicklungsstudios verwendet wird. Unreal Engine ist bekannt für seine atemberaubende Grafik, realistische Physiksimulation und fortschrittliche Funktionen für künstliche Intelligenz.
  • Özellikler:
    • Hochwertige 3D-Grafik-Engine
    • Realistische Physiksimulation
    • Fortschrittliche Tools für künstliche Intelligenz
    • Visuelle Programmierfähigkeiten
    • Große Asset-Bibliothek (voreingestellte Modelle, Animationen, Texturen)
    • Unterstützung bei der VR- und AR-Entwicklung
  • Avantajları:
    • Perfekt für die Erstellung von Spielen auf professionellem Niveau.
    • Dank seines breiten Funktionsumfangs bietet es Spieleentwicklern große Flexibilität.
    • Es hat eine große und aktive Community.
  • Nachteile:
    • Es gibt eine komplexe Lernkurve.
    • Es erfordert einen leistungsstarken Computer.
    • Es basiert auf einem kostenpflichtigen Lizenzmodell (Abonnement oder projektbasierte Preisgestaltung).

2. Einheit:

  • Überblick: Unity ist eine beliebte Spiele-Engine, die von Unity Technologies entwickelt wurde. Dank seiner einfach zu bedienenden Benutzeroberfläche und den umfangreichen Lernressourcen ist es ideal für Einsteiger in die Spieleentwicklung. Mit Unity können sowohl 2D- als auch 3D-Spiele erstellt werden.
  • Özellikler:
    • Benutzerfreundliches Bedienfeld
    • Unterstützung für die Entwicklung von 2D- und 3D-Spielen
    • Visuelle Programmiertools (Bolt)
    • Große Asset-Bibliothek
    • Optimiert für die Entwicklung mobiler Spiele
  • Avantajları:
    • Für Anfänger ist es leicht zu erlernen.
    • Es können sowohl 2D- als auch 3D-Spiele erstellt werden.
    • Es hat eine große und aktive Community.
    • Kostenloses Lizenzmodell verfügbar (bis zu einer bestimmten Einkommensgrenze).
  • Nachteile:
    • Es ist nicht so leistungsstark wie die Unreal Engine, um die komplexesten Spielmechaniken zu erstellen.
    • Da es sich auf die Entwicklung mobiler Spiele konzentriert, können Desktop-Spiele einige Einschränkungen aufweisen.

3. Godot:

Überblick: Godot ist eine kostenlose Open-Source-Spiele-Engine, mit der 2D- und 3D-Spiele erstellt werden können. Godot ist relativ einfach zu erlernen und zu verwenden und bietet eine flexible Spieleentwicklungsumgebung

  • Funktionen (Fortsetzung):
    • Benutzerfreundliches Bedienfeld
    • Visuelle Programmierskripte
    • Integrierte Physik-Engine
    • Umfangreiche 2D- und 3D-Asset-Bibliothek
    • Unterstützung für die Spieleentwicklung auf mehreren Plattformen (Desktop, Mobilgerät, Web)
  • Avantajları:
    • Da es kostenlos und Open Source ist, bietet es eine kostengünstige Spieleentwicklung.
    • Dank der benutzerfreundlichen Oberfläche und den visuellen Programmiermöglichkeiten ist es für Einsteiger geeignet.
    • Es vereint 2D- und 3D-Spieleentwicklung in einem Programm.
    • Unterstützt von einer aktiven Community.
  • Nachteile:
    • Für die Entwicklung der komplexesten AAA-Spiele ist sie möglicherweise nicht so leistungsstark wie Unreal Engine oder Unity.
    • Da es sich um eine weniger bekannte Spiel-Engine handelt, sind die Online-Lernressourcen möglicherweise begrenzter als bei anderen.

4. GameMaker Studio:

  • Überblick: GameMaker Studio ist eine von YoYo Games entwickelte Spiel-Engine mit besonderem Fokus auf die Entwicklung von 2D-Spielen. GameMaker Studio erleichtert dank seiner benutzerfreundlichen Oberfläche und visuellen Programmiersprache die Erstellung von 2D-Spielen ohne Programmierkenntnisse.
  • Özellikler:
    • Es wurde speziell für die Entwicklung von 2D-Spielen entwickelt.
    • Visuelle Programmiersprache (GameMaker Language – GML).
    • Erweiterte Physiksimulation mit der Physics 2D-Engine.
    • Integrierte Raum- und Bildverwaltungstools.
    • Große 2D-Asset-Bibliothek.
  • Avantajları:
    • Dank seines Schwerpunkts auf der Entwicklung von 2D-Spielen ist es leicht zu erlernen und zu verwenden.
    • Spiele können ohne Programmierkenntnisse erstellt werden.
    • Es ermöglicht eine schnelle und effiziente Entwicklung mit für 2D-Spiele optimierten Funktionen.
    • Es hat eine große und aktive Community.
  • Nachteile:
    • Es unterstützt nur die Entwicklung von 2D-Spielen und kann nicht für 3D-Spiele verwendet werden.
    • GML, eine visuelle Programmiersprache, die keine Codierung erfordert, kann für komplexe Spielmechaniken eingeschränkt sein.
    • Im Vergleich zu anderen Spiel-Engines bietet es möglicherweise weniger Flexibilität.

5. CryEngine:

  • Überblick: CryEngine wurde von Crytek entwickelt und ist eine leistungsstarke und vielseitige Spiele-Engine, die häufig von AAA-Spielestudios bevorzugt wird. CryEngine ist dafür bekannt, atemberaubenden Realismus und überragende Grafikqualität zu liefern.
  • Özellikler:
    • Die fortschrittlichsten Grafiktechnologien
    • Echtzeit-Raytracing-Unterstützung
    • Hochleistungsphysiksimulation
    • KI-Tools
    • Sandbox-Bearbeitungstools
  • Avantajları:
    • Es bietet höchste Grafikqualität mit fotorealistischen visuellen Fähigkeiten.
    • Ideal für die Entwicklung von Open-World-Spielen und großen Spielumgebungen.
    • Es bietet die Möglichkeit, mit Sandbox-Bearbeitungstools schnell und einfach Spielwelten zu erstellen.
  • Nachteile:
    • Die Lernkurve ist komplex und die Anwendung erfordert Fachwissen.
    • Es erfordert einen sehr leistungsstarken Computer.
    • Es gibt kein kostenloses Lizenzmodell, für die kommerzielle Nutzung ist eine kostenpflichtige Lizenz erforderlich.

Allgemeine Merkmale von Game-Design-Programmen

Game-Design-Programme verfügen im Allgemeinen über die folgenden Grundfunktionen:

  • Diagrammtools: Game-Design-Programme bieten Tools, mit denen Benutzer Grafiken erstellen und bearbeiten können, die sie in ihren Spielen verwenden können. Diese Tools können eine Vielzahl von Funktionen umfassen, z. B. das Erstellen von Sprites, das Modellieren, das Erstellen von Animationen und das Erstellen von Effekten.
  • Codierungsagenten: Einige Spieledesignprogramme umfassen Codierungstools, mit denen Benutzer benutzerdefinierte Funktionen und Verhaltensweisen in ihren Spielen erstellen können. Diese Tools ermöglichen das Schreiben von Code in verschiedenen Programmiersprachen und können zur Bestimmung der Logik und Funktionalität des Spiels verwendet werden.
  • Asset-Bibliothek: Game-Design-Programme enthalten oft eine Bibliothek mit vorgefertigten Assets (z. B. Charaktere, Hintergründe, Objekte usw.), die Benutzer in ihren Spielen verwenden können. Mit diesen Assets können Benutzer ihre Spiele schnell erstellen und Prototypen erstellen.
  • Physik-Engine: Die Physik-Engine ist ein Tool, das die physikbasierten Interaktionen des Spiels verwaltet. Diese Engines ermöglichen die Simulation von Objektbewegungen, Kollisionen, Schwerkraft und anderen physikalischen Wechselwirkungen.
  • Audio- und Musikunterstützung: Mit Game-Design-Programmen können Benutzer ihren Spielen häufig Sound und Musik hinzufügen. Dies kann Benutzern dabei helfen, ihre Spiele atmosphärischer und fesselnder zu gestalten.
  • Plattformunterstützung: Game-Design-Programme ermöglichen die Verbreitung von Spielen auf verschiedenen Plattformen (Computer, Mobil, Web, Konsole usw.). Dies ermöglicht es Benutzern, ihre Spiele einem breiten Publikum zugänglich zu machen und sie auf verschiedenen Geräten spielbar zu machen.

Die Art des Spiels, das Sie entwickeln möchten, wirkt sich auf das Programm aus, das Sie wählen sollten. Wenn Sie beispielsweise ein 2D-Side-Scrolling-Spiel erstellen möchten, ist GameMaker Studio möglicherweise eine gute Wahl. Wenn Sie ein Ego-Shooter-Spiel erstellen möchten, sind Unreal Engine oder Unity möglicherweise besser geeignet.

INTERNATIONAL
Diese könnten dir auch gefallen
Kommentar